Different from the Market
Most stands on the market are 3D printed – and they tend to be rough, light, and fragile (no offense intended). That’s why we use imported premium resin, the same material found in those high-end collectible pieces, to build our stand. Our version weighs 3 times as much as the typical 3D printed ones. After all, a stand should have a solid, substantial feel.
